ROADMAP

Current v0.0.1 (Pre-Alpha)

Goal: Fix the core math, clean up the UI, add manual overrides, and lay the foundation for new calculation tools.

  • [ ] Fix REBA & RULA Math: Verify that the math for REBA and RULA is 100% accurate and matches standard scoring charts.
  • [ ] Test with Real Data: Set up automated tests with sample data to catch calculation bugs or rounding errors early.
  • [ ] Fix Crashes & Logs: Move logging to an asynchronous setup and fix race conditions causing background task crashes.
  • [ ] Clean Up PyQt6 UI: Remove broken buttons and placeholder menus. Fully implement the global Settings page and finish the live data dashboard.
  • [ ] Add Manual Overrides: Allow users to manually input Force/Load values and save these inputs to the session.
  • [ ] Refactor Code Architecture: Clean up the base calculator code to make it easy for developers to integrate new tools later.

v0.1.0 (Alpha)

Goal: Establish a stable core and GUI while adding new ergonomic calculation engines.

  • [ ] Stable Core and GUI: Complete an audit of the core engine and interface to fix remaining bugs and stabilize operations.
  • [ ] Add NIOSH Lifting Engine: Integrate the NIOSH Lifting Equation to handle complex, multi-task lifting calculations.
  • [ ] Add OCRA Index: Build out the tools for the Occupational Repetitive Actions index and checklists.
  • [ ] Add Snook & EWAS Tables: Implement EWAS and Snook tables for pushing, pulling, and carrying operations using array-based lookups.

v0.2.0 (Beta)

Goal: Conduct thorough real-world QA testing, resolve edge-case bugs, and optimize calculation speeds.

  • [ ] Bug Fixes: Identify and resolve user-facing bugs and interface inconsistencies.
  • [ ] Real-World QA Testing: Test application features in real-world settings and update logic based on user feedback.
  • [ ] Numba Optimization: Use Numba to compile heavy mathematical functions into native machine code for faster execution.
  • [ ] Performance Audit: Run performance benchmarks on calculation loops using large datasets.

v0.3.0+ (Production)

Goal: Continuous bug fixing, performance tuning, and adding minor feature updates only as strictly necessary.

v1.0.0 (Production)

Goal: Launch a complete, fully audited, and thoroughly tested standalone tool with minimal external dependencies.

Quality Standards

  • Code Testing: Maintain at least 90% automated test coverage for all math and calculation code.
  • Code Cleanliness: Ensure zero errors or security warnings when running ruff and bandit.
  • Documentation: Ensure all code documentation strictly passes pydoclint checks.
